Output 51f0fb6a126206dbaa954932efd2f23c7f1c2ea55f62b9b6e71af5e92809a066:0

value
139916695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cca6310cafc555cb531aa04a5dbd49008e73298 OP_EQUAL
address
MByzQxt53ndi4wthS5fJr9Gu752fYP6fwr
transaction
51f0fb6a126206dbaa954932efd2f23c7f1c2ea55f62b9b6e71af5e92809a066
spent
true